[edit] Quest information
[edit] Requirements
Dunkoro must be in your party.
[edit] Objectives
- Bring Dunkoro to meet with Kormir in Nightfallen Jahai.
- Travel through Nightfallen Jahai with Kormir and Dunkoro.
- Speak with the Tortured Sunspear.
- See Jarindok for your reward.
[edit] Reward
- 2,500 Experience
- 200 Gold
- 100 Lightbringer Points
[edit] Walkthrough
Walk out north at Gate of Torment into Nightfallen Jahai. Speak with Kormir and follow the way north. Take care to aggro only one group at a time as two groups will probably kill you; the mobs here are significantly more difficult than those in Kourna and Vabbi. Speak with the Tortured Sunspear. After a cutscene you will find yourself in Gate of Pain.

[edit] Intermediate dialogue 2
- Dunkoro: "What is this, Kormir? And, more importantly, what are you doing here?"
- Kormir: "This is Nightfallen Jahai. It is but a shadow of the Jahai Bluffs of our world. Abaddon has dreamed it into being, and when the dream is complete, the bluffs will fall into night. This is what Abaddon will do to our world if not stopped."
- Kormir: "As for me, I found myself trapped here, pulled bodily into this realm. I am still blind, yet can sense pain around me. I fear that I, like others, have been contaminated by Abaddon's touch, and my body and spirit are now bound here by that foul taint."
- Kormir: "All those who come into contact with Abaddon are fated to come here. It is the only way to prevent their contamination of the rest of reality. As long as Abaddon's presence remains, he will corrupt all he can reach, and doom them to eternal torment here."
- Kormir "The Dark God of Secrets was contained here once; unable to harm those of our world. But he has begun to break free, and he moves the walls of his prison outward. Unless we defeat him, he will turn all Elona into a nightmare realm like this one."
- Dunkoro "Defeat him? Kormir, that's madness. How can we fight a god? There must be something else we can do; some other way to stop this from happening."
- Kormir "The time for caution has passed, Dunkoro. Every moment we delay is another moment Abaddon uses to grow stronger and reach further into Elona. I need your strategic insights, not your doubts. We need a plan."
- Dunkoro "A plan? For defeating a god? That may be beyond my strategic capabilities."
